diff --git a/aplay/aplay.c b/aplay/aplay.c index 2e14d2a..837e46a 100644 --- a/aplay/aplay.c +++ b/aplay/aplay.c @@ -287,7 +287,7 @@ static void pcm_list(void) name = snd_device_name_get_hint(*n, "NAME"); descr = snd_device_name_get_hint(*n, "DESC"); io = snd_device_name_get_hint(*n, "IOID"); - if (io != NULL && strcmp(io, filter) == 0) + if (io != NULL && strcmp(io, filter) != 0) goto __end; printf("%s\n", name); if ((descr1 = descr) != NULL) {